Choosing a Florence Moving Company

To choose a moving company, you'll first need to finalize the details of your move to know whether a local or national mover is right for your needs. Movers can also be split into full-service and self-service movers. Full-service moving companies provide packing and loading services, which are a big stress-reliever if you loathe packing boxes. Self-service moving companies provide a truck and driver, but you're expected to have your things packed when they get there. Some of the ways you can learn about a company's reputation are through online reviews and the BBB. You can also check to see which movers near you meet all of South Carolina's mover licensing requirements. Every company on our list of the best movers in Florence is well-reviewed and picked by our experts. Once you've put together a small list of companies to select from, you can get in touch with each of them and ask about a free estimate. We highly recommend speaking with two or more of the companies from our list above. Be sure to explain to them all of the services that you're looking for, and to check that the provided estimate is a "binding estimate." Otherwise, it may be subject to change.

How Much Do Movers in Florence Cost?

Cost is a big concern when talking about moving. The typical amount one might expect to spend hourly for movers in Florence is:

  • Average: $57 per hour
  • Range: $43 to $72 per hour
Moving costs can also be estimated using the size of your home. The usual cost to move homes of various sizes in Florence is:
  • One bedroom: About $3,838
  • Two bedrooms: About $4,106
  • Three bedrooms: About $4,598

  • Some movers offer specialty services for items like antiques, pianos, and other valuables. During the estimate process, tell the company's representative about the high-value items you need to move. Ensure that the team has the proper experience and resources to move your valuables, and make sure that they have superior insurance in case of loss, damage, or theft.

    A few signs that you shouldn't use a specific mover include:

    • The company avoids questions about its insurance, experience, and licensure.
    • The mover offers promotions, discounts, or quotes that sound too good to be true.
    • The mover can't direct you to references.
    • The company demands that you pay upfront.
    • The company isn't in good standing with the Better Business Bureau or Federal Motor Carrier Safety Agency.
